Tworzenie warstwy prezentacyjnej w rozproszonych systemach

Transkrypt

Tworzenie warstwy prezentacyjnej w rozproszonych systemach
Java Enterprise Conference
Kraków 2000
Mamy zaszczyt zaprezentować Państwu wstępną ofertę udziału w przygotowywanej przez
Polish Java User Group, ogólnopolskiej konferencji Java Enterprise Conference.
Tematyka konferencji
platforma Java 2 Enterprise Edition, Enterprise Java Beans,
serwery aplikacji, elektroniczna wymiana dokumentów – XML,
zastosowania najnowszych technologii internetowych, rozwiązania
Busines-to-busines i Busines-to-consumer
Uczestnicy
projektanci, programiści i specjaliści z branży IT, architekci
systemowi, integratorzy systemów, studenci oraz przedstawiciele
świata nauki
Koszt udziału
bezpłatnie
Liczba uczestników
około 270 osób
Język
polski i angielski (nie tłumaczony)
Czas trwania
20-21 listopada 2000 roku
Miejsce
Kraków, szczegóły ustalamy
Aktualni partnerzy
Altkom Akademia – 3 przemówienia
BEA System – 2 przemówienia
BSC Polska oraz Borland – 1 przemówienia
InfoViDE – 1 przemówienie
Amaio Technologies, Inc.– 1 przemówienie
Inne firmy
zainteresowane
Spodziewane atrakcje
Novell, IBM, Sun Microsystems, Wrox
Zapisy
Wkrótce na stronie www.java.pl
Dodatkowe informacje
Poprzez e-mail: [email protected]
Konkurs z nagrodami i inne, zależne od pomysłów i możliwości
sponsorów.
Aktualnie, zaproponowane tematy przez zainteresowane firmy we wstępnej kolejności.
Istnieje możliwość dopasowania kolejnych nawet pomiędzy już przedstawione.
Dzień 1
Architektura systemów internetowych w oparciu o platformę Java
Adam Lejman
Altkom Akademia
Słuchacze:
 Projektanci i programiści systemów opartych o technologię Java;
 Integratorzy systemów.
 Architekci systemowi.
Czas trwania: 1.5h
Celem wystąpienia jest przedstawienie sposobu budowania systemów internetowych z
wykorzystaniem rozwiązań platformy Javy. Zostaną omówione podstawowe wzorce
architektury stosowane w wybranych rodzajach systemów; zastosowania technologii J2EE,
mechanizmy integracji z działającymi systemami.
Tematy:
 rodzaje systemów internetowych
 wzorce biznesowe systemów
 wzorce architektury
 wzorce projektowe
 technologie warstwy prezentacyjnej – servlety, JSP, XML, WAP
 technologie warstwy logiki aplikacyjnej – EJB
 technologie warstwy danych – JNDI, JMS, XML
 technologie komunikacyjne RMI, IDL
Tworzenie warstwy prezentacyjnej w rozproszonych systemach
internetowych
Michał Szklanowski i Emila Smółko
Altkom Akademia
Słuchacze:
 Projektanci i programiści systemów opartych o technologię Java;
 Programiści HTML (web designer);
 Architekci systemowi.
Czas trwania: 1.5h
Wystąpienie przybliży metody budowy interfejsu użytkownika w oparciu o architekturę
cienkiego klienta. Przedstawi korzyści płynące z zastosowania technologii Servletów i JSP.
Omówi najczęściej stosowane metody komunikacji z warstwą biznesową czy danych.
Tematy:
 Od CGI do Servletów;
 Podstawy programowania Servletów;





Ciasteczka i sesje - kontekstowość komunikacji;
JSP a Servlety;
Podstawy składni JSP;
Zawansowane JSP - modułowa budowa stron i definiowanie własnych znaczników;
Przykład zastosowania;
Dzień 2.
Java, XML, komponenty - architektura dla e-systemów
InfoViDE
Profil odbiorcy/uczestnika:
Architekt systemowy
Projektant systemów e-biznes (rozproszonych)
Kierownik IT
Czas trwania wystąpienia: 1 godzina
Tworzenie systemów gospodarki elektronicznej wymaga zastosowania technologii, które
sprostają nowym wyzwaniom. Do wyzwań tych należy zaliczyć dużą dynamikę rynku,
konieczność stałego pozyskiwania i utrzymywania klientów (rozwiązania Business-toCustomer), konieczność elastycznego kształtowania relacji z partnerem biznesowym
(rozwiązania Business-to-business) oraz potrzebę utrzymywania coraz bardziej złożonej
infrastruktury informatycznej własnej firmy.
W ramach seminarium pokażemy w jaki sposób platforma Enterprise Java pozwala na
rozwiązywanie problemów związanych z nową rzeczywistością. Omówimy także takie
aspekty e-biznesu jak budowa systemu z komponentów czy wykorzystanie dokumentów
XML do wymiany danych wewnątrz firmy i pomiędzy różnymi organizacjami.
Wystąpienie będzie opierało się na prezentacji następujących wzorców architektur:
 Architektury integracyjnej (Enterprise Application Integration)
 Architektury spersonalizowanego centrum kontaktowego (rozwiązanie Business-toCustomer)
 Architektury dla kontaktu z partnerem biznesowym (rozwiązanie Business-to-business)
Dla każdego wzorca architektury przedstawiony zostanie schemat realizacji przy użyciu
technologii Enterprise Java Beans i języka XML. Przedstawione przykłady wykorzystywać
będą informacje zdobyte podczas projektów przeprowadzonych przez firmę InfoViDE.
Kolejki komunikatów - nowy sposób integracji systemów.
Piotr Jachimczyk i Grzegorz Smółko
Altkom Akademia
Słuchacze:
 Projektanci i integratorzy systemów.
 Programiści.
Czas trwania: 1.5h
Wystąpienie przedstawi zastosowanie kolejek jako medium komunikacyjnego. Zaproponuje
wykorzystanie standardu XML do wymiany danych. Przedstawi przykładowe rozwiązanie z
zastosowaniem tych technologii.
Tematy:
 Pojęcie komunikatu.
 Kolejki - co to takiego?
 JMS - Java i kolejki.
 Sposoby wymiany danych.
 XML jako przenośny format danych.
 Parsery SAX i DOM.
 Przykład zastosowania
When vision becomes reality
Vladimir Lahoda, Technical Director
Amaio Technologies, Inc.
Czas trwania: 1h
Delivering applications over the Internet is a phenomenon unanimously predicted by market
researchers, IT professionals, and technical audience. In a rare unison technicians and
journalists draw bright future where happy users download all sorts of applications from the
network and store all their data in hyper-spacious, hyper-secure, hyper-available hypercenters. The company data-centers are going to die-out followed by the intelligent
workstations. Then the vision becomes reality: Third Stage of Computing or Network is the
Computer. Nowadays we are still quite far from that vision, however, players are already on
stage and the play has begun.
What is the current state of ASP market? What is probable scenario of further development?
What are major challenges that ASPs are facing today? What is the role of Java and XML in
the new era? These and other questions will be discussed.
Plaant, the flagship of Amaio Technologies, Inc., is a development framework designed
specifically for ASP purposes. It is a set of tools substantially shortening time-to-market of
business applications, facilitating their maintenance, administration, and continuous
development. Mission, architecture and functionality of Plaant and how Plaant benefits from
tight Java and XML interconnection will be explained.
Firmy jeszcze przygotowujące wystąpienie:
BEA Systems, BSC Polska, Novell
Oferta dla sponsorów i innych firm zainteresowanych:
www.java.pl/wydarzenia/JECK2000_oferta.html

Podobne dokumenty